Six Teams Selected To Unveil New Nike City Connect Uniforms During 2023 Season

MLB and Nike announced the return of City Connect uniforms with six teams selected to unveil a new design during the 2023 season.

The Atlanta Braves (April 8 debut), Texas Rangers (April 21), Seattle Mariners (May 5), Cincinnati Reds (May 19), Baltimore Orioles (May 26) and Pittsburgh Pirates (June 27) are the clubs scheduled to debut new City Connect uniforms this year.

The Dodgers were part of the inaugural seven teams with a Nike City Connect uniform in 2021, along with the Boston Red Sox, Miami Marlins, Chicago White Sox, Chicago Cubs, Arizona Diamondbacks and San Francisco Giants.

Then in 2022, the City Connect program was expanded to feature the Colorado Rockies, Houston Astros, Kansas City Royals, Los Angeles Angels, Milwaukee Brewers, San Diego Padres and Washington Nationals. The Dodgers wore their all-blue uniform for a handful of games last season.

The Nike MLB City Connect program was created to celebrate the bond between each team and its city. The uniform series explores the personality, values and customs that make each community and their residents unique.

“Over the course of its first two seasons, the Nike MLB City Connect Series has been the most successful consumer product initiative we’ve ever had,” MLB chief revenue officer Noah Garden said in a statement.

“The overwhelmingly positive response from our fans is clear when you see ballparks full of these distinct designs and colors.

“Our Clubs have focused so much time and effort with Nike to create these exceptional uniforms for their fan bases, and it shows in every last detail. We look forward to seeing even more of our parks filled with City Connect jerseys this season.”

Dodgers unveiled new City Connect cap for 2022 season

Although the Dodgers kept their inaugural City Connect uniform design last season, they did make minor changes to the cap. “Los Dodgers” was replaced by the traditional logo and shifted to the right side in smaller font. Furthermore, the bill of the Dodgers lid was changed to black.
